A methodology for an optimal design of ground-mounted photovoltaic

The first type, ground-mounted photovoltaic, has a fixed tilt angle for a fixed period of time. The second type uses a solar tracker system that follows Sun direction so that the maximum power is obtained. The solar tracking can be implemented with two axes of rotation (dual-axis trackers) or with a single axis of rotation (single-axis trackers).

What are solar panel brackets?

Solar Panel Brackets: The Ultimate Guide, types and best options. Solar panel brackets are an essential component of any solar panel system. They are used to secure solar panels onto rooftops, ground mounts, or other structures. The brackets are designed to withstand harsh weather conditions and provide a secure foundation for the panels.

What is a side-of-pole solar bracket?

A side-of-pole solar bracket is a mounting system used to install solar panels on the sides of poles or posts. This type of bracket allows for easy and secure installation, making it ideal for applications where roof or ground mount systems are not suitable.

What is a top-of-pole solar bracket?

The top-of-pole solar bracket is a mounting system used to securely install solar panels on top of a pole or post. It is designed to provide stability and optimal positioning for the solar panels, allowing them to capture maximum sunlight for efficient energy generation.

What is a photovoltaic mounting system?

Photovoltaic mounting systems (also called solar module racking) are used to fix solar panels on surfaces like roofs, building facades, or the ground. These mounting systems generally enable retrofitting of solar panels on roofs or as part of the structure of the building (called BIPV).
